Cancer Incidence in Five Continents is published by?

1) North American Association of Central Cancer Registries (NAACCR).
2) National Program of Cancer Registries (NPCR).
3) Surveillance, Epidemiology, and End Results (SEER) program.
4) International Association of Cancer Registries (IACR).

Final answer:

The 'Cancer Incidence in Five Continents' is published by the International Association of Cancer Registries (IACR).

Step-by-step explanation:

The publication Cancer Incidence in Five Continents is published by the International Association of Cancer Registries (IACR). This organization works in collaboration with the World Health Organization (WHO) to disseminate information regarding the incidence of cancer in different geographic regions. The publication is a significant resource for researchers and healthcare professionals around the world, providing valuable data for cancer surveillance and epidemiological studies.
